Size and Weight Limits
Choosing the right pet stroller for your small dog means paying close attention to size and weight limits to guarantee safety and comfort. First, make sure the stroller’s maximum weight capacity exceeds your pet’s current weight, giving room for growth and any accessories. Check the internal dimensions to ensure your dog can sit, lie down, and turn comfortably during rides. It’s also important to consider the stroller’s overall weight—if it’s too heavy, it might be difficult for you to carry or lift. Additionally, confirm that the stroller fits easily into your vehicle trunk or storage space for convenient transport. Finally, match the size limits with your usual walking routes and terrain to keep your pet safe and comfortable on every outing.
Terrain Compatibility Needs
Selecting a stroller that matches the terrain you typically walk on is essential for your small dog’s comfort and safety. For rough or uneven surfaces, look for all-terrain wheels that can handle gravel, dirt, or sand, while smooth-rolling wheels are better for urban sidewalks. Front swivel wheels with locking features improve maneuverability on rocky or uneven paths. A suspension system or shock absorbers can make rides smoother on bumpy grass or cobblestones. Larger, rubber, or foam-filled wheels perform better on loose or uneven ground, providing stability and ease of movement. Also, a sturdy, wide wheelbase enhances balance, preventing tipping on slopes, curbs, or loose terrain. Matching your stroller to your typical walking environment ensures safer, more comfortable outings for your small dog.

Safety Features Included
Have you ever considered how safety features can make or break your small dog’s stroller experience? These features are essential for peace of mind and your pet’s well-being. Secure zippers, harness attachments, and internal tethers keep your dog safely inside, preventing escapes. Braking systems, whether foot brakes or lockable front wheels, ensure stability when parked. A sturdy frame and reinforced fabric panels add durability, reducing the risk of collapse or structural failure. Mesh windows and covers not only provide ventilation but also shield your pet from insects and debris. Plus, safety elements like reflective trims or bright colors boost visibility during low-light walks, making outings safer. Prioritizing these features guarantees your small dog stays secure, comfortable, and protected on every adventure.
Ventilation and Visibility
When choosing a pet stroller for your small dog, ventilation and visibility are essential for comfort and safety. Proper ventilation is achieved through mesh panels, breathable fabric, or windows that allow fresh air to circulate, preventing overheating during walks. Multiple airflow openings or adjustable windows give you control over ventilation based on weather and your pet’s needs. Visibility is equally important; transparent or mesh sides let your dog observe their surroundings, reducing anxiety and promoting comfort. Clear sightlines also enhance your supervision, so you can easily monitor your pet’s well-being. Well-designed ventilation and visibility features ensure your small dog stays comfortable, cool, and secure, making outdoor adventures more enjoyable for both of you.

Budget and Value
Selecting a pet stroller that fits your budget helps guarantee you get the best value without overspending. Before shopping, I recommend setting a clear price range since options can vary from under $50 to over $200 based on features and materials. It’s important to balance cost with durability, safety, and comfort—cheaper models might save you money upfront but could lack strong brakes, secure closures, or sturdy wheels, leading to higher repair costs later. I also consider essential features like good ventilation, easy folding, and enough space for my pet’s comfort relative to the price. Often, investing a bit more in a well-reviewed, durable stroller pays off through better safety, comfort, and longevity, ultimately saving money and ensuring my small dog’s happiness during outings.

How Do I Clean and Maintain a Pet Stroller Effectively?
To keep your pet stroller clean and well-maintained, I recommend regularly wiping down the surfaces with a damp cloth and mild soap. Vacuum out any debris from the wheels and fabric folds often. Check for loose screws or wear and tear, tightening or repairing as needed. I also suggest removing the fabric lining periodically for a deeper clean, ensuring your stroller stays fresh, safe, and comfortable for your pet.
